Interstate 90 - Auxiliary Routes

Auxiliary Routes

  • Rapid City, South Dakota - I-190
  • Chicago, Illinois - I-190 (provides a direct route to O'Hare International Airport), I-290
  • Cleveland, Ohio - I-490
  • Buffalo, New York - I-190, I-290, I-990 (not directly connected)
  • Rochester, New York - I-390, I-490, I-590 (not directly connected)
  • Syracuse, New York - I-690
  • Utica, New York - I-790
  • Schenectady, New York - I-890
  • Spur to I-495 in Marlborough, Massachusetts - I-290
  • Spur to Leominster, Massachusetts - I-190

I-90 is the only interstate to have a complete set of auxiliary routes (i.e., all nine possible three-digit route numbers) within a single state, that being New York.
